Output 802e516095fc01a9accc7c2e7c1f78a7b385d80dc57162367317d896f9f99e43:0

value
2482733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1058d926c4d210032bac21cd71dea007cda558d7 OP_EQUAL
address
33BTAu1XJHHVhm93ibszyT4waoNMDREZrk
transaction
802e516095fc01a9accc7c2e7c1f78a7b385d80dc57162367317d896f9f99e43
confirmations
182504
spent
true